Abstract
A series of non-peptide competitive antagonists of the human IMR 90 fetal lung fibroblast bradykinin B2 receptor have been designed and synthesized. Compound 15 binds with an affinity constant Ki = 60 nM. The SAR leading to the design of these non-peptide antagonists is described.
